Parrot Bebop 2 With Skycontroller - Full Specifications

Icon
Flight
Max Flight Time25.0 min.
Icon
Camera
Built-in camerayes
Camera Resolution14.0 Mpx
Live Viewyes
Max range (Video/FPV)300
Video recordingyes
Video Resolution1080p
Maximum FPS at the highest resolution30.0 fps
Max Image Size4096x3072
Icon
Dimensions
Number Of Rotors4
Weight17.64 oz
Width15.04 in
Depth12.91 in
Height3.5 in
Propeller guard includedno
Icon
Battery
Battery includedyes
Capacity2700.0 mAh
TypeLithium Polymer
Voltage11.1 V
Charging via USBno
Icon
Features
Ready To Flyyes
Brushless motoryes
Radio transmitteryes
Follow me functionyes
GPSyes
Icon
Controller
Range2000
Icon
Connectivity
Bluetoothno
Wi-Fiyes
USByes
Mobile appyes
Icon
Misc
Primary useFilm & Photography
Memory card readerno

Review: Parrot Bebop drone and Skycontroller

As the latest in Parrot's line of smartphone-operated drones, the Bebop boasts a number of improvements over the AR.Drone 2.0 including a better camera, longer range, and an optional joystick-based controller. We put the Bebop in the hands of several quadcopter neophytes, tested it indoors (which…
